Overview: The C programming language remains a preferred choice for developing high performance, embedded systems. For students without any programming experience, learning to use the C programming language can be challenging. The book series provides a practical step-by-step approach to systematically understand and apply the basics of the language. In particular, it aligns with first year engineering courses such as APSC 160 at The University of British Columbia (Point Grey campus). Volume I consists of five chapters: Where to Start?, Fundamentals, Branch Control Statements, Loop Control Statements, and File Input/Output.
